1. Sorts

Categorizing automated grout cleansing gear by kind is crucial for understanding the vary of obtainable choices and choosing probably the most applicable instrument for a given activity. Several types of these machines make use of distinct cleansing mechanisms, every with its personal set of benefits and drawbacks.

  • Upright Brush Machines

    These machines make the most of rotating brushes, usually mixed with a cleansing resolution dishing out system, to wash grout traces. They’re generally used for bigger ground areas and provide a steadiness of energy and maneuverability. Examples embrace fashions with cylindrical or disc-shaped brushes, some that includes adjustable brush speeds and strain settings. Upright brush machines are usually efficient for routine cleansing and average soil removing.

  • Excessive-Strain Water Jet Machines

    These machines make use of pressurized water streams to blast away dust and dirt from grout traces. They’re extremely efficient for eradicating cussed stains and deeply embedded dust. Some fashions provide adjustable strain settings and specialised nozzles for varied cleansing duties. Excessive-pressure water jet machines are perfect for heavy-duty cleansing and restoration tasks however require cautious dealing with to keep away from damaging tiles or grout.

  • Steam Cleaners

    Steam cleaners make the most of high-temperature steam to sanitize and clear grout traces. The warmth successfully loosens dust and kills micro organism, mould, and mildew. Steam cleansing is a chemical-free cleansing methodology, making it appropriate for environmentally aware customers or these with sensitivities to cleansing chemical compounds. Nevertheless, steam cleaners won’t be as efficient as different varieties for eradicating closely embedded dust or stains.

  • Handheld Grout Cleaners

    These compact and moveable items are designed for smaller areas and spot cleansing. They sometimes make use of oscillating brushes or small-scale water jets. Handheld grout cleaners are handy for element work and reaching tight areas. Whereas efficient for gentle to average cleansing, they may not be as environment friendly as bigger machines for intensive ground areas.

The selection of machine kind will depend on elements equivalent to the dimensions of the world to be cleaned, the severity of soiling, and particular cleansing necessities. Understanding the capabilities and limitations of every kind ensures optimum choice and efficient grout cleansing outcomes.

3. Cleansing Energy

Cleansing energy represents a vital efficiency metric for tile ground grout cleaner machines. Efficient removing of ingrained dust, grime, mildew, and stains is crucial for sustaining the aesthetic attraction and hygiene of tiled surfaces. Understanding the elements that contribute to cleansing energy allows knowledgeable choices relating to gear choice and utilization.

  • Brush Design and Rotation Pace

    Brush design considerably influences cleansing efficacy. Stiff-bristled brushes are efficient for eradicating cussed dust, whereas softer bristles are gentler on delicate tiles. Brush rotation velocity instantly impacts scrubbing energy. Larger speeds generate extra friction, enhancing cleansing motion however doubtlessly growing the chance of floor abrasion. Matching brush kind and rotation velocity to the particular tile and grout materials is essential for optimum cleansing and stopping injury.

  • Water Strain and Stream Price

    In machines using water jets, strain and stream charge are key determinants of cleansing energy. Excessive-pressure jets successfully dislodge embedded dust and dirt. Stream charge influences the quantity of water delivered, affecting rinsing effectivity. Balancing strain and stream charge is crucial for attaining thorough cleansing with out extreme water utilization or potential injury to the grout.

  • Steam Temperature and Strain

    Steam cleaners depend on the temperature and strain of the steam to loosen and take away dust. Larger temperatures improve cleansing and sanitizing effectiveness. Steam strain influences the power with which steam is utilized to the grout traces. Optimizing steam temperature and strain is essential for efficient cleansing and minimizing the chance of tile injury.

  • Cleansing Resolution Compatibility

    The effectiveness of cleansing options performs a major position in total cleansing energy. Compatibility between the cleansing resolution and the tile and grout materials is paramount. Utilizing inappropriate options can result in discoloration, etching, or different injury. Choosing cleansing options particularly formulated for tile and grout enhances cleansing efficiency and safeguards the integrity of the surfaces.

The interaction of those elements determines the general cleansing energy of a tile ground grout cleaner machine. Cautious consideration of those parts, along side the particular cleansing activity and floor supplies, ensures optimum cleansing outcomes and preserves the longevity of tiled surfaces. Efficient cleansing energy interprets to a cleaner, extra hygienic, and aesthetically pleasing atmosphere.

7. Noise Ranges

Noise ranges generated by tile ground grout cleaner machines characterize a vital consideration, significantly in noise-sensitive environments equivalent to residences, hospitals, places of work, and different business areas. Extreme noise can disrupt actions, create discomfort, and doubtlessly contribute to noise air pollution. Understanding the elements influencing noise output and out there noise discount methods allows knowledgeable gear choice and operational practices.

  • Decibel Scores and Human Notion

    Noise ranges are sometimes measured in decibels (dB). A better decibel ranking signifies a louder sound. Human notion of loudness is logarithmic, which means a ten dB enhance represents a perceived doubling of loudness. Machines working at increased decibel ranges can contribute to auditory fatigue and discomfort. Choosing machines with decrease decibel rankings, significantly for indoor use, minimizes noise-related disruptions. For instance, a machine rated at 60 dB is considerably quieter than one rated at 80 dB, representing a considerable distinction in perceived loudness.

  • Impression of Machine Design and Operation

    Machine design and operational parameters considerably affect noise output. Motor measurement and sort, brush or impeller velocity, and total building contribute to noise technology. Excessive-speed elements and poorly insulated motors have a tendency to supply increased noise ranges. Producers usually implement noise discount applied sciences equivalent to sound dampening supplies and vibration isolation programs to attenuate noise output. Understanding the connection between machine design and noise ranges permits for number of quieter working fashions. For instance, a machine with a direct-drive motor could be louder than one with a belt-driven system, which presents some noise discount.

  • Environmental Elements

    The encircling atmosphere can affect perceived noise ranges. Laborious surfaces like tile and concrete replicate sound, amplifying noise, whereas softer supplies like carpets and curtains take up sound, lowering its depth. Working a machine in a big, open area with onerous surfaces will lead to increased perceived noise ranges in comparison with working the identical machine in a smaller, carpeted space. Consideration of environmental elements helps mitigate noise affect and ensures a extra snug working atmosphere. Moreover, the presence of background noise can both masks or exacerbate the noise produced by the machine, influencing total perceived loudness.

  • Noise Discount Methods

    Implementing noise discount methods can decrease the affect of machine operation on the encompassing atmosphere. Utilizing listening to safety equivalent to earplugs or earmuffs reduces noise publicity for operators. Scheduling cleansing actions throughout off-peak hours minimizes disruption to occupants. Using noise limitations or sound-absorbing supplies within the cleansing space helps include and dampen noise. These methods collectively contribute to a quieter and extra snug atmosphere for each operators and occupants of the encompassing area. For instance, scheduling cleansing actions throughout off-peak hours in a business setting minimizes disruption to workers and prospects, whereas utilizing noise limitations in an industrial setting can successfully include and cut back noise propagation.

Ideas for Efficient Grout Cleansing

Optimizing cleansing outcomes requires a strategic method encompassing gear choice, operational strategies, and applicable cleansing options. The next suggestions present sensible steering for attaining superior outcomes and sustaining the long-term integrity of tiled surfaces.

Tip 1: Floor Preparation
Completely sweep or vacuum the tiled floor earlier than using mechanized cleansing. Eradicating unfastened particles prevents clogging of the machine and enhances the effectiveness of the cleansing course of. This preliminary step ensures optimum contact between the cleansing mechanism and the grout traces.

Tip 2: Resolution Choice
Select cleansing options particularly formulated for tile and grout. Take into account the kind of tile and grout materials, in addition to the character of the soiling, when choosing a cleansing agent. Keep away from harsh chemical compounds that might injury or discolor the surfaces. At all times take a look at the cleansing resolution in an not easily seen space earlier than widespread utility.

Tip 3: Tools Optimization
Alter machine settings, equivalent to brush velocity, water strain, or steam temperature, in accordance with the producer’s suggestions and the particular cleansing activity. Begin with decrease settings and regularly enhance depth as wanted to keep away from damaging delicate surfaces. Make the most of applicable attachments for various grout line widths and configurations.

Tip 4: Approach and Utility
Apply the cleansing resolution evenly and permit it to dwell for the beneficial time earlier than activating the machine. Information the machine slowly and steadily alongside the grout traces, overlapping passes barely to make sure full protection. Keep away from extreme strain or scrubbing, which may injury the grout or tiles. For cussed stains, a number of passes or pre-treatment with a specialised cleansing agent could also be mandatory.

Tip 5: Water Administration
Management the stream of water to stop extreme saturation of the grout or surrounding areas. Make the most of the machine’s suction or water restoration options to gather wastewater and particles. Dry the cleaned space completely after cleansing to stop water spots or mildew development.

Tip 6: Publish-Cleansing Upkeep
Rinse the machine completely after every use, eradicating any residual cleansing resolution or particles. Clear brushes, nozzles, and different elements in accordance with producer suggestions. Correct upkeep prolongs gear lifespan and ensures constant cleansing efficiency.

Tip 7: Common Cleansing Schedule
Set up a daily cleansing schedule based mostly on the extent of foot site visitors and soiling. Frequent cleansing prevents the buildup of deeply embedded dust and dirt, simplifying upkeep and preserving the looks of tiled surfaces. A proactive method to grout cleansing minimizes the necessity for intensive restoration efforts.
